Chelsea are planning to sign the Colombian striker
from Monaco in the coming window.
Monaco signed Falcoa from Atlético Madrid for a fee believed
to be around 60 million euros in summer. The Colombian has proved his worth in
Ligue 1 by scoring eight goals in eleven games for the French side.
The 27-year-old striker has netted twenty goals in forty
nine appearances for Colombia which shows that he also proved himself on
international level. He is currently on international duty, recently scored a
goal in a 2-0 win over Belgium in a friendly match.
Chelsea are preparing a big money move for him which
is around 55 million pounds according to reports. Chelsea are also planning to
offload their Spanish striker Fernando Torres who has been struggling since his
big money move from Liverpool.
Chelsea have a big striking problem, Torres and Ba are
not good enough while Eto’o is too old. So Chelsea need a good striker that can
cause troubles for opponent’s defense and Falcao is the right player for it.
